On Friday, 31 May, a group of talented students in Years 3 to 6 participated in the annual CSSA State Cross Country event at the Sydney International Equestrian Centre in Horsley Park.The venue provided excellent opportunities for spectators to closely watch the exciting finish of each race.
Mr Archer praised the efforts of the students: ‘All SGCS students displayed remarkable commitment and determination, competing against over 180 runners in each event. The challenging hilly course tested their endurance and spirit, and we commend each student for their committed efforts.’
